Post E-3 update
It's a little late for this, I know. But I spent most of the weekend finishing up Kingdom Hearts. When I wasn't playing the game however, I was looking up and watching a lot of the Electronic Entertainment Expo (E3)

Usually I come away from this conference happy and excited about the upcoming year. While I'm far from a fanboy of any of the systems (though I am a rampant Microsoft hater...boo Mr. Gates, boo), I've been most impressed with Sony's performances in recent years. They've just had the best console around for the last two generations, imo. I firmly expected them to continue being the console of choice for the next-gen systems.

After this year's E3, I guess I have to learn to live with some disappointment. Sure, the PS3 looks great. The games sound like a lot of fun, and exciting, to boot. I'll admit I liked seeing FFXIII, and a few other titles for it.

I'm NOT paying $600 for a fucking system. I don't give a shit about blue-ray technology. I also don't care if the system's technically a "deal" for the price it could be worth. To me, Sony's basically trying to push their shit through the PS3, and the price is suffering. What's more, I'm expecting games to cost approx. $70 a pop.

Sony may be the best of the systems, but it's not worth that much. How many families are going to spend that kind of money? Chances are (even if the wii hasn't stated a price yet) you could buy an Xbox360 AND a Wii COMBINED for cheaper than a PS3.

It's not like Nintendo's making things any better, however. The Wii looks too gimmicky to me. It strikes me as something that Nintendo fanboys, and probably critics will love. but when it comes down to it, I doubt it will sell any better than the Gamecube or N64.

What this leaves me with -and this pains me beyond all belief- is the XBox360. And sadly/surprisingly/annoyingly, the games don't look bad. Gears of War and Too Human seem like serious gaming. Mass Effect looks good too. Personally, 'm not a Halo fan, but Halo 3 should be fun too. Things are really looking up for them, in my opinion.

Overall though, I think the next console generation may turn out to be a disappointing one, based on whats currently on the big 3 company plans. I hope for the sake of game players everywhere that this is not the case. Only time will tell.
